The Pilgrim Society and Pilgrim Hall Museum, located in historic Plymouth, MA seeks a full-time Executive Director who will energetically further the organization’s mission to promote worldwide awareness of the Pilgrims’ significance as an enduring narrative of America’s founding. The Pilgrim Society, established in 1820, operates Pilgrim Hall Museum, the oldest public museum in the country, featuring the largest collection of Pilgrim artifacts. The museum has an active schedule of exhibitions, public events and educational programs. The Society has an annual operating budget of $640,000.
